>I don't know if this is too simplistic, but why can't you set up a windows printer for the docutec (?) that prints to file instead of the device? Then you send them the file and they copy it to the port...
>
>Lo-tech, but, ahem, it does work < s >.
>
>>>>I need to have our office services department print a very large report for
>us... They use a DocuTec printer which requires that jobs be in the PostScript format...
>>>>
>>>>Can VFP generate reports to a file in this format? If not, they say that they can convert an MS Word document into PS, so does VFP (6.0) generate word docs? Hmmmm what about VFP -> RTF format -> Word -> PS format?
>>>>
>>>>Kludgy, but it might work...
>>>>
>>>>TIA
>>>
>>>
>>>Postscript is simply a printer language...like PCL. Sure, VPF can output Postscript. You just need the correct printer driver.
>>
>>Did I mention that I'd need to deliver the report to Office Services in a file? They won't be printing directly from VFP... Is that possible?

This is the resolution we're using ... seems to work fine... except... the report is over 25,000 pages and we can't seem to get past page 9999 because of the 'to' page number on the dialog box. This is true even when "Print range" is not selected. We've also tried using PRINTJOB with _PBPAGE and _PEPAGE but same result...

Any ideas?
